記事一覧
技術記事・日々の学びをまとめています。
エンジニアが学ぶ生産管理システムの「知識」と「技術」
エンジニアが学ぶ生産管理システムの「知識」と「技術」
最新記事
エンジニアが学ぶ物流システムの「知識」と「技術」
エンジニアが学ぶ物流システムの「知識」と「技術」
データベース正規化を解説:1NFから3NFまで実例付き
データベース正規化を 1NF・2NF・3NF まで実例付きで解説。冗長性排除・更新anomaly防止のためのテーブル設計の考え方を学べます。
初めてのSQL 第3版
初めてのSQL 第3版
理論から学ぶデータベース実践入門 ~リレーショナルモデルによる効率的なSQL
理論から学ぶデータベース実践入門 ~リレーショナルモデルによる効率的なSQL
SQLアンチパターン
SQLアンチパターン
達人に学ぶSQL徹底指南書 第2版 初級者で終わりたくないあなたへ
達人に学ぶSQL徹底指南書 第2版 初級者で終わりたくないあなたへ
SQL実践入門──高速でわかりやすいクエリの書き方
SQL実践入門──高速でわかりやすいクエリの書き方
データベースインデックスとは?仕組みと必要なタイミング
データベースインデックスとは何か、B-Tree・ハッシュインデックスの仕組み・効果的に使う場面・作り過ぎのデメリットを解説します。
キャパシティプランニング ― リソースを最大限に活かすサイト分析・予測・配置
キャパシティプランニング ― リソースを最大限に活かすサイト分析・予測・配置
キャパシティプランニングについて
キャパシティプランニングを解説。パフォーマンス要件定義、インフラ稼働状況計測、将来予測、安全率設定でリソース効率化とSLA達成を実現する実務手法を紹介します。
DB設計のID設計:UUID vs 連番 vs ULID の選び方
DB 設計における ID の選び方を解説。UUID・連番(AUTO_INCREMENT)・ULID それぞれのトレードオフとユースケースを比較します。
DB設計におけるNULL:よくある落とし穴とベストプラクティス
DB 設計における NULL の扱い方を解説。NULL を使う場面・避けるべき場面・よくある落とし穴とベストプラクティスをまとめます。
パスワード付きPDFの解除をするワンライナー
コマンドラインツールQPDFを使い、パスワード付きPDFの制限を安全に解除するワンライナーを紹介します。
Kubernetesのコンポーネント解説:Pod・Node・コントロールプレーン
Kubernetes の各コンポーネントを解説。Pod・Node・コントロールプレーン(API Server / etcd / Scheduler / Controller Manager)の役割を学べます。
ジョブ理論
ジョブ理論
Cloud Spannerの知見メモ|設計・運用のポイント
Cloud Spannerのノード・スプリット・レプリケーション仕様、ホットスポット対策とインデックス最適化を実装・検証する知見
NGINXのバッファ系ディレクティブ解説:プロキシパフォーマンスの最適化
NGINX のリバースプロキシ用バッファ系ディレクティブを解説。proxy_buffering・proxy_buffer_size などの設定がパフォーマンスに与える影響を学べます。
SaaSのアーキテクチャについて知るためのリスト
SaaSのアーキテクチャについて知るためのリストについて、設計原則とトレードオフ、実践的な適用方法を詳しく解説します。
実務で使える メール技術の教科書 基本のしくみからプロトコル・サーバー構築・送信ドメイン認証・添付ファイル・暗号化・セキュリティ対策まで
実務で使える メール技術の教科書 基本のしくみからプロトコル・サーバー構築・送信ドメイン認証・添付ファイル・暗号化・セキュリティ対策まで